Court Dismisses Auction Rate Securities Class Action For Simpson Thacher Client

By

In an order dated March 31, 2012, Judge Paul Gardephe of the Southern District of New York granted J.P. Morgan Securities LLC’s motion to dismiss federal securities fraud claims brought on behalf of a putative class of purchasers of auction rate securities (ARS) over a nearly four-year period. The suit related to the widespread failures of auctions for ARS in February 2008 as a result of which many investors were unable to sell their securities at auction.
